A founder effect occurs when a new colony is started by a few members of the original population. The founder effect is the loss of genetic variation that occurs when a new population is established by a small number of founders. Founder effect is the loss of genetic variation that occurs when a small group of individuals is separated from a larger group and then establishes a new. The founder effect is a random evolutionary process that occurs when a small group of individuals forms a new, isolated population.
